About This Book

Did you know the Bill of Rights is like a super shield that protects your freedoms every day? These first ten amendments to the Constitution make sure your voice is heard and your rights are safe. Understanding them helps you see why fairness and freedom matter to everyone!

Quick Assessment

This early reader introduces children ages 5-8 to the first ten amendments of the United States Constitution, known as the Bill of Rights. It provides a simple and accessible explanation of fundamental civil rights and constitutional protections. The content is appropriate for young readers with no intense or sensitive material.
